Canon celebrates 10 years anniversary of EOS 5D series

May 28, 2015. Canon celebrates 10th anniversary of famous EOS 5D camera series. EOS 5D, released in September 2005., Was the first semi-professional DSLR-camera with a full-frame CMOS-sensor 35,8×23,9 mm and completely changed the DSLR market. The relatively economical new product allowed amateur photographers to take the highest quality photos and use the tools previously available only to owners of professional DSLRs with 35mm sensors in their creative work. EOS 5D makes major contribution to the spread of full-frame photography.

In November 2008. Canon has presented the second generation of cameras – EOS 5D Mark II which has opened wide possibilities of video. Revolutionary Full HD video capture function later added to many DSLRs.

Canon’s development has transformed the video and film production industry, giving operators a full-frame video camera at a bargain price. Outstanding image quality and fine control over depth of field also took full advantage of Canon’s comprehensive EF lens range, which at the time included 64 lenses.

EOS 5D Mark III, released in March 2012., Enhanced still and video capabilities, higher-precision autofocus, and faster maximum continuous shooting speed. The camera has at once deserved recognition and became one of flagships of further development of EOS series.

More recently, February this year saw the introduction of the latest EOS 5DS and EOS 5DS R featuring super-resolution sensors, which revolutionised the EOS system. New cameras surpasses models with 35-mm sensors and possess the greatest resolution on all history of the full frame – 50,6 Mpiks.

All key components of Canon’s EOS digital cameras are manufactured in-house, so the range offers the highest level of reliability. Continuous technological innovation has equipped these cameras, including the EOS 5D series, with everything needed to deliver the ultimate in image quality.

EOS DSLRs enjoy well-deserved support from professionals and amateurs alike, and Canon will continue to develop the lineup to meet the demands of a wide range of users.
